We go every September after Labor Day.
The Last 3 years the hours were something like this.

MK 9 am-6 pm on mon-thrus
Mk 9 am-8/9pm Fri/Sat/Sun and there is usually a night parade and fireworks on one of these days but not on all three.
MGM 9 am - 7/8 pm Don't remember if Fantasmic was every night.
AK 9 am - 5 pm
Epcot 9 am - 7 pm
Epcot WS 11 am - 9 pm Illuminations every night

It sounds like short hours but the crowds are so low it doesn't matter.

While the "historic hours" are helpful, be careful! Business took a real dive at WDW after 9/11. It is coming back with a roar. WDW continues to make adjustments in Park hours depending on crowds they anticipate. With 30,000 rooms on-property, WDW has a pretty good idea what "the books" look like & they will make adjustments accordingly. Use the "histories" for guidance, but be sure to pick up a brochure at check-in with Park & event hours!
